Responsible Gambling Initiatives

Responsible gambling is a critical consideration for any platform involved in sports betting or similar interactive activities. Platforms have a moral and legal obligation to protect vulnerable individuals and prevent problem gambling. This includes providing resources for responsible gambling, offering self-exclusion options, and implementing tools that allow users to set limits on their spending and activity. Transparency is also essential, ensuring that users understand the risks associated with gambling and have access to clear and concise information about the platform's policies and procedures. Promoting responsible gambling is not only ethically sound but also contributes to the long-term sustainability of the industry.

  1. Implement Age Verification: Ensure that all users are of legal age to participate in sports betting.
  2. Provide Self-Exclusion Options: Allow users to voluntarily exclude themselves from the platform.
  3. Set Spending Limits: Enable users to set daily, weekly, or monthly deposit and wagering limits.
  4. Offer Responsible Gambling Resources: Provide links to organizations that offer support for problem gambling.
